Who Should Apply for Key Retirement Aid in Idaho

In Idaho, the grant targeting retired music educators is specifically tailored for those individuals who have served in public or private educational institutions across the state. Eligibility is predominantly based on the need for financial assistance, particularly regarding ongoing medical expenses that have become increasingly burdensome. Retirees who have dedicated decades to nurturing the musical talents of Idaho’s youth are at the forefront of this initiative, as their contributions have often influenced the state’s robust arts community.

To be considered for this funding, applicants must meet essential criteria which typically include providing proof of prior employment in a music education capacity within Idaho schools. This may require documentation such as letters of employment or certification records from educational bodies in the state. Additionally, applicants must demonstrate financial need, which usually involves the submission of financial statements or an overview of current expenses, especially related to medical care. The straightforward application process is designed to ensure that help reaches those who need it most without unnecessary bureaucratic hurdles.

Idaho's unique demographic and geographic characteristics further guide the eligibility criteria. With a significant rural population, many retired educators reside in remote areas where access to healthcare facilities can be limited. As such, the grant places particular emphasis on assisting individuals from these rural communities, where they face challenges that differ markedly from their urban counterparts.
